a mass m is suspended at one end of a spring and the other end of the spring is fimly fixed on the celling. if the mass is slightly depressed and released it will execute oscillation. If the spring is cut into two equal halves and one half of the spring is used to suspend the same mass then obtain an expression for the ratio of periods of oscillation in two cases.
